The Brookwood Forest Off Shoots Garden Club is holding its annual “Deck the Hood” tree sale through Nov. 10.

The trees, 5-foot to 6-foot North Carolina Pines are on sale for $35 each. Event sale Co-Chair Christina Powell said all proceeds will benefit Brookwood Forest Elementary. Trees can be purchased by mailing or taking a check to 3505 Spring Valley Court in Mountain Brook.

Trees will be delivered Nov. 24-25, said Powell, and will be staked in the ground according to the buyer’s preferences on Nov. 26-27. From there, buyers are asked to decorate their trees outside and help “light up the Brookwood Forest area.”

Once the trees are decorated, said Powell, the Off Shoots Garden Club will organize an event — group caroling with hot chocolate, for example — to help showcase the trees.

“This is a great opportunity to decorate the neighborhood and get people out and about,” said Powell. “The club is made up of a great group of women in the area that are always trying to do different things for the community.”
